Boone County Brown pours a mostly clear, dark amber color. Thin, wispy head that dissipates pretty quickly. Aroma has some caramel malt and light espresso that really draws you in. Taste has roasted malt flavors, milk chocolate, caramel, and coffee, but each flavor is well represented and balanced. Slight hop bitterness, which is a welcome surprise. And it's not sweet, which we really enjoy as some brown ales get too sweet on the back end. Light body with a smooth, creamy mouthfeel. Super drinkable, exactly what we're looking for in this style.
